Mohammad Mohitul Haque Enam Chowdhury
Mohammad Mohitul Haque Enam Chowdhury is a distinguished Bangladeshi judge affiliated with the International Crimes Tribunal. He is known for his work in upholding the rule of law and ensuring justice in cases of international crimes, contributing to the historical and legal narrative of Bangladesh.
